Few goddesses honor the archetypes of both lover and warrior quite like goddess Freyja, also spelled Freya and Freia. This solar feminine deity comes from the Norse word for “lady” and we have her to thank for our word Friday, aka Freyja’s Day.

In Norse traditions, people called on Freyja to invite more love into their lives, and for them love and war weren’t so separate. Freyja was said to be the most beautiful of the goddesses, though not just a pretty face, she was also the queen of the battle-maidens called Valkyries.

She decided, with the Zeus-like god Odin, which slain souls would go where and would escort them to her palace in the afterlife. She drove a chariot driven by cats and was mistress to the gods as she had a reputation for being a flirt. In northern areas of the world, she is credited with bringing magic to humankind.

For this reason, Freyja is associated with magic, love, sensuality, strength, power, and devotion. She offers us esteem and focus, and of course a deep connection with cats.( I even named my kitty after her and she is of course sitting next to me as I write this.) ;) The cat-like goddess Freyja also has a reputation for being an ardent and sensual lover.

One myth about Freyja involves the story of her most prized possession, the necklace of Brisings. One day she was walking past a stone and it opened to reveal four dwarves making a necklace. She loved the necklace and offered them gold and silver for it, though they said no and instead asked for a night with her. She said yes and four nights later left with her necklace. In ancient Norse times, Freyja was often seen in the sky wearing her necklace of gems and precious metals…also known as the Milky Way.
